Some times you have to wonder just what people are thinking.

http://www.latimes.com/nation/nationnow/...story.html

"A bison calf that tourists loaded into their vehicle at Yellowstone National Park because they were concerned for its welfare could not be reunited with its herd and had to be euthanized, park officials said Monday as they reasserted the importance of avoiding wildlife."

They're probably lucky they didn't get stomped.
